Application Programming Interface (API)

Introduction

Application Programming Interface (API) has become an integral part of the modern digital landscape. It allows different software applications to communicate and interact with each other, enabling seamless integration and data exchange. APIs have revolutionized the way businesses operate, providing opportunities for innovation, efficiency, and growth. In this article, we will explore the concept of APIs, their importance in finance, and how they are transforming the industry.

Understanding APIs

APIs serve as a bridge between different software systems, enabling them to exchange data and functionality. They define a set of rules and protocols that govern how applications should interact with each other. APIs can be compared to a waiter in a restaurant, taking orders from customers (applications) and delivering them to the kitchen (server) to fulfill the request.

APIs come in various forms, including web APIs, operating system APIs, and library APIs. Web APIs, also known as HTTP APIs or REST APIs, are the most common type used in modern applications. They use the HTTP protocol to enable communication between applications over the internet.

The Importance of APIs in Finance

The finance industry heavily relies on APIs to streamline operations, enhance customer experiences, and drive innovation. Here are some key reasons why APIs are crucial in finance:

  • Integration: APIs allow different financial systems to seamlessly integrate with each other. For example, banks can integrate their systems with payment gateways to enable online transactions.
  • Data Exchange: APIs facilitate the exchange of data between financial institutions, enabling real-time access to information such as account balances, transaction history, and market data.
  • Third-Party Services: APIs enable financial institutions to offer third-party services to their customers. For instance, a bank can integrate with a personal finance management app to provide customers with a holistic view of their finances.
  • Automation: APIs automate manual processes, reducing human error and increasing efficiency. For example, APIs can be used to automate the reconciliation of transactions between different systems.
  • Innovation: APIs foster innovation by allowing developers to build new applications and services on top of existing financial systems. This encourages collaboration and drives the creation of innovative solutions.

APIs in Action: Case Studies

Let's take a look at some real-world examples of how APIs are transforming the finance industry:

1. Stripe

Stripe, a leading online payment processing platform, provides a powerful API that allows businesses to accept payments online. By integrating with Stripe's API, businesses can securely process credit card payments, manage subscriptions, and handle complex payment flows. This API has revolutionized the way businesses handle online transactions, making it easier for startups and small businesses to accept payments.

2. Plaid

Plaid is an API platform that enables financial institutions to connect with users' bank accounts and access transaction data. By integrating with Plaid's API, fintech companies can offer services such as account verification, transaction categorization, and income verification. Plaid's API has become a crucial component for many financial apps and services, providing secure and reliable access to banking data.

3. Open Banking

Open Banking is a regulatory initiative that requires banks to provide access to customer data through APIs. This initiative aims to promote competition and innovation in the financial industry by allowing third-party developers to build applications and services on top of banking systems. Open Banking APIs enable customers to securely share their financial data with authorized third parties, such as budgeting apps and investment platforms.

The Future of APIs in Finance

The role of APIs in finance is expected to continue growing in the coming years. Here are some trends and predictions for the future of APIs in finance:

  • Open Finance: APIs will play a crucial role in the development of open finance, where customers will have greater control over their financial data and can easily switch between financial service providers.
  • Blockchain Integration: APIs will facilitate the integration of blockchain technology into financial systems, enabling secure and transparent transactions.
  • Artificial Intelligence: APIs will be used to integrate AI-powered solutions into financial applications, enabling personalized recommendations, fraud detection, and risk assessment.
  • Regulatory Compliance: APIs will help financial institutions comply with regulations by securely sharing data with regulators and automating compliance processes.

Conclusion

APIs have become the backbone of the modern finance industry, enabling seamless integration, data exchange, and innovation. They have transformed the way financial institutions operate and interact with customers. APIs have empowered businesses to offer new services, automate processes, and provide personalized experiences. As the finance industry continues to evolve, APIs will play an even more significant role in driving innovation and shaping the future of finance.

Leave a Reply